Deep Diving into Segmentation Perspectives to Reveal How Product Types, Forms, Applications, and Distribution Channels Define Growth Trajectories in Tree Nut Markets
A nuanced understanding of market segmentation reveals critical growth pathways for different categories within the tree nut universe. When examining product type, almonds continue to command a leading position due to their versatility and well-established supply chains, while Brazil nuts and macadamias occupy niche spaces propelled by unique flavor profiles and premium positioning. Cashews and pistachios have seen sustained demand in snack applications, supported by innovation in roasted and seasoned formats. Simultaneously, hazelnuts and walnuts find extended usage in chocolate confections and plant-based dairy alternatives, with manufacturers leveraging their distinct fatty acid compositions to enhance product functionality.
In terms of product form, the market is evolving beyond traditional raw offerings toward higher-value derivatives such as flour and meal, where finely milled almond meal serves as a gluten-free baking staple, and oil applications extend into culinary and cosmetic formulations. Paste and butter formats are also enjoying accelerated adoption, with creamy textures meeting consumer desires for convenient, high-protein spreads. Meanwhile, raw nuts maintain a core role within snacking portfolios, often serving as the foundational ingredient for further processing.
The breadth of application channels further underscores the sector’s dynamism. In confectionery and bakery applications, tree nuts contribute texture and flavor complexity, while in the cosmetics and pharmaceutical sphere, nut-derived oils and extracts are integrated for moisturizing and skin-beneficial properties. Dairy alternatives highlight the growing appetite for plant-based milks and cheeses, where almond and cashew bases are most prevalent, and snack innovation spans everything from energy bars to savory nut clusters.
Finally, distribution strategies illustrate how consumer access points shape competitive advantage. Traditional retail remains a cornerstone, with modern trade channels providing expansive in-store visibility, while online purchasing models-whether through brand direct-to-consumer platforms or third-party e-commerce marketplaces-enable targeted marketing, subscription offerings, and direct feedback loops. This combination of offline and online ecosystems ensures that brands can tailor experiences to evolving shopper behaviors, maximizing both reach and engagement.

Mapping Regional Variations and Growth Opportunities for Tree Nut Producers and Suppliers Across the Americas, Europe, Middle East & Africa and Asia-Pacific
Regional dynamics within the tree nut sector are defined by distinct consumption patterns, production specializations, and market access considerations. In the Americas, almond cultivation in California underpins a robust export-oriented framework, while Mexican pistachio producers are expanding acreage to meet rising global demand. Walnut growers in Chile and Argentina further bolster the region’s export capacities, supported by investments in cold chain logistics that preserve quality during transit. At the same time, domestic retail penetration in North America is driving innovation in value-added snack formats and plant-based dairy analogs, aligning product portfolios with wellness and convenience trends.
Europe, the Middle East, and Africa exhibit a mosaic of opportunities shaped by diverse regulatory environments and consumer tastes. Mediterranean countries leverage long-standing traditions in olive oil and nut processing, introducing almond oils and hazelnut pastes into both culinary and cosmetic markets. Northern European markets, characterized by health-driven purchasing decisions, prioritize nuts as functional ingredients in cereal bars and specialty baked goods. In the Middle East, cashew kernels command premium pricing in confectionery applications, while high disposable incomes in the Gulf Cooperation Council drive demand for imported premium nut assortments. Across Africa, emerging processing facilities in South Africa and Ghana are beginning to unlock export potential in macadamias and raw cashews, attracting development funding and technical support.
The Asia-Pacific region presents perhaps the most dynamic growth trajectory, buoyed by rising disposable incomes, urbanization, and shifting dietary habits. Indian cashew processing represents one of the largest global ecosystems, supplying bulk volumes to foodservice and retail channels. Meanwhile, consumer education campaigns in China and Japan have elevated awareness of nut-based health benefits, catalyzing demand for snack packs and on-the-go formats. Australia’s macadamia industry continues to expand export partnerships, and Southeast Asian markets are increasingly sourcing almonds for local bakery and confectionery manufacturers. Together, these three regions map a panorama of differentiated drivers that require localized strategies to unlock maximum growth potential.

Evaluating Leading Market Players and Strategic Collaborations Driving Innovation, Operational Excellence, and Competitive Advantages in the Global Tree Nut Landscape
Leading companies in the tree nut arena are distinguished by their ability to integrate sustainable practices, product innovation, and strategic partnerships into scalable business models. Agribusiness cooperatives specializing in almonds have achieved market leadership through coordinated grower networks that optimize harvesting schedules and implement standardized quality checks. Meanwhile, global commodity traders and food ingredient conglomerates are expanding their downstream presence by acquiring niche processors of specialty nuts and related value-added products, securing access to proprietary formulations and broader distribution channels.
On the innovation front, forward-thinking firms are launching new product lines that harness nut water-a byproduct of nut milk production-as a natural beverage base, while others invest in enzymatic treatments to reduce allergenicity and create hypoallergenic alternatives. Collaborative research agreements with universities and technology start-ups are facilitating advancements in mechanized harvesting and post-harvest sorting, driving both yield improvements and labor cost reductions. At the same time, digital platforms that connect growers with end buyers are proliferating, enabling real-time pricing transparency and demand forecasting that sharpen inventory management across the supply chain.
Beyond organic growth initiatives, joint ventures between regional processors and multinational food corporations are enabling market entry in previously underserved geographies. These alliances combine local market expertise with global branding power, accelerating product launches in retail, foodservice, and digital channels. As the competitive environment intensifies, these strategic imperatives-sustainability leadership, product diversification, and collaborative growth-will continue to shape the capabilities that define tomorrow’s industry champions.
